Biennio Accademico di II Livello ordinamentale

PRESENTATION
At the end of the studies related to the second level Academic Diploma, the student must have broadened the knowledge of the techniques and specific skills already acquired in the first level three-year period and must be able, on the basis of this advanced knowledge, to concretely realize his artistic idea. To this end, particular emphasis will be given to the study of the most representative repertoire of the instrument - including the ensemble one - and the relative executive practices, also with the aim of developing the student's ability to interact within differently composed musical groups. These objectives must also be achieved by expanding the development of perceptive hearing and memorization skills and with the acquisition of specific knowledge relating to the organizational, compositional and analytical models of music and their interaction. At the end of the two-year period, the student must have acquired an in-depth knowledge of the general stylistic, historical and aesthetic aspects relating to his specific field. Finally, as a result of learning from an advanced study cycle, it is expected that he has developed those learning skills that allow him to continue studying mostly in a self-directed or autonomous way.

Triennio Accademico di I livello ordinamentale

presentaTION

At the end of the studies related to the first level Academic Diploma in Baroque Flute, students must have acquired the knowledge of historical techniques and the specific skills that allow them to concretely realize their artistic idea. To this end, particular emphasis will be given to the study of the most representative repertoire of the instrument - including the ensemble one - and the relative executive practices, also with the aim of developing the student's ability to interact within differently composed musical groups. These objectives must also be achieved by promoting the development of perceptive hearing and memorization skills and with the acquisition of specific knowledge relating to the organisational, compositional and analytical models of music and their interaction. Specific care must be dedicated to the acquisition of adequate postural and emotional control techniques. At the end of the three-year period, students must have acquired in-depth knowledge of the general stylistic, historical and aesthetic aspects relating to their specific field. Furthermore, with reference to the specificity of the individual courses, the student must possess adequate skills related to the field of improvisation and ornamentation. The training objective of the course is also the acquisition of adequate skills in the field of musical information technology as well as those relating to a second community language.

Propedeutico

PRESENTATION

The preparatory courses, organized in a single study cycle, are aimed at preparing the tests for access to first level academic study courses. They include teachings that pertain to four disciplinary areas: characterizing interpretative or compositional, theoretical-analytical-practical, ensemble interpretative and musicological.
